Morning Nausea

Hi, I am taking 60mg Prozac in the morning (past 4 weeks) and then 100mg Lithium (down from 200) with .5mg Clonazepam at bedtime for depression. Since upping the prozac from the original 20 I find that i feel quite nausious in the mornings often with the need to pass loose motions 3 or 4 times. It does fade a bit during the day but I'm not sure what may be causing this. Any ideas?
